Announced on January 13 \, 2021\, the Secretary of the Interior designated 21 new and two updated National Historic Landmarks. These 23 historic sites illustrate importan t aspects of American history and represent a diverse array of historic p eriods\, cultural groups\, property types\, and archeological sites from across the nation. The Apothecary Museum was nominated for its contributi ons to fields of business and science\, within the theme of developing th e American economy. As noted in the nomination\, ?The Stabler-Leadbeater Apothecary Shop is nationally significant in the history of pharmacy in t he nineteenth and early twentieth centuries\, particularly the evolution of drug stores and the changing role of pharmacists.?\n
